Auburn University is home to the NextFlex Harsh Environment
Node – a major node of the newly awarded Flexible Hybrid Electronics
Manufacturing Institute (FHEMII).  NextFlex is an institute for advancing the manufacturing of Flexible Hybrid Electronics (FHE). AU has significant infrastructure for design and development of harsh environment electronics under CAVE3 Electronics Center established in 1999. 

Goals of NextFlex and AU Harsh Node of NextFlex   

The primary institute goal is to accelerate technology adoption into advanced products by developing and commercializing advanced manufacturing technologies.  The institute will leverage the electronics
industry and the high performance printing industry, both well-established US industrial and academic areas of strength. The five FHE core manufacturing focus areas are included below:

Manufacturing focus areas include:
  • Device Integration and Packaging
  • Materials
  • Printed Flexible Components and Microfluidics
  • Modeling and design
  • Standards, Test & Reliability

What do Companies hope to gain from the Institute?
Companies engaging in partnership with the institute can do the following: 

  1. Become part of teams that bid on project calls on the topic of flexible electronics
  2. Align focus proposed projects with their next-generation product needs
  3. Ability to task project teams with development of product technology demonstrator in pre-competitive format
  4. Realize the benefits of 1:1 cost-share provided by the federal grant to the institute
